Abstract :
When an indoor coverage area is designed in mobile communication systems, it is important to estimate the received power from an outdoor base station in order to evaluate the interference level indoors. This paper evaluates outdoor-to-indoor radio propagation with 800 MHz band through measurement campaigns at the lower multiple floors of some buildings in an urban environment. The evaluation result shows that propagation loss in an area close to a window does not follow the existing formula where loss is predicted in proportion to distance.
